About the Company

Carle Health is a vertically integrated system with more than 11,500 employees in its hospitals, physician group, health plan, and associated healthcare businesses. Headquartered in Urbana, IL, Carle Health is a not-for-profit organization dedicated to providing high-quality, compassionate care. As a leading provider in the Midwest, we are committed to improving the health and well-being of the communities we serve through innovative patient care, research, and education. Key Responsibilities

  • Accompany physicians during patient examinations and accurately document the patient's medical history, physical exam findings, diagnoses, and treatment plans in the electronic health record (EHR).
  • Transcribe dictated information from providers efficiently and accurately.
  • Maintain strict patient confidentiality and adhere to all HIPAA regulations.
  • Assist with retrieving previous medical records, lab results, and imaging studies for review by the provider.
  • Communicate effectively and professionally with providers, staff, and patients.
  • Learn and adapt to various medical specialties and terminology.
  • Ensure all documentation is completed in a timely and comprehensive manner.
